顺、反式结构对MPV异构体的分子构型和吸收光谱的影响
Influence of cis and trans structures on molecular conformation and UV spectra of MPV isomers
【摘要】 采用量子化学B3LYP/6-31G 方法,分别优化、计算了MPV三种异构体的几何和电子结构.结果表明,在异构体中反式结构为平面构型,顺式结构为非平面构型,反式结构增加可使异构体的UV最大吸收峰有规则红移.解释了实验现象,并对烷氧基取代聚对苯乙炔中的顺、反异构及其对相关性质的影响进行了有益的讨论.
【Abstract】 The geometrical and electronic structures of three MPV isomers were calculated by B3LYP/6-31G* method of quantum chemistry,respectively.The results are that :the part of trans structure is planar conformation and the part of cis structure is non-planar conformation.The increase of trans structure quantity can make the UV .λmax of isomer red-shift regularly,which explains the experiment phenomena.
